Abstract

An optical probe that measures the level of a liquid in a tank includes a transparent and refracting optical waveguide for receiving an injection of a collimated light beam. The optical waveguide internally reflects the collimated light beam according to a total reflection regime in any part of the optical waveguide located in a gaseous medium and refracts the collimated light beam according to a refraction regime in any part of the optical waveguide immersed in a liquid medium. The optical waveguide switches from the total reflection regime to the refraction regime at the interface between the gaseous medium and the liquid medium, and mirrors are arranged around said optical waveguide and reverse the path of a light beam collimated and refracted by the optical waveguide, the optical path covered by the collimated light beam representing the level of the liquid in the tank.
